Training for emerging producers
Cooperation and collaboration are on everyone's agenda, from big festivals and cultural agencies to new artistic collectives. Is it easy to work and share with others in a time of excessive individualism and apply market values in the field of the performing arts? How can we create our own community, when even stable cooperation structures are being challenged, such as the EU with the upcoming Brexit?
These questions resonate even stronger for young professionals under the pressure of building a new network and learning from their peers. Three of our members with expertise in administration, production and international touring will share their knowledge and create new tools with a group of young professional producers.
Open to a limited group, this training is aimed at emerging producers with a maximum of 5 years of professional experience. Examining collaboration on various levels, is it possible to cooperate with other individuals of the performing arts, within your own team and within a complex ecosystem? In an international network of producers and programmers, what can we observe?
This training will offer practical tools, exercises and presentations in two sessions.
